Non-GamStop casinos have become an increasingly popular non GamStop casino option for players who want to explore online gambling beyond the restrictions of the UK’s GamStop self-exclusion program. Unlike casinos regulated by the UK Gambling Commission, these sites operate independently and are usually licensed by foreign authorities such as those in Curacao or Malta. This distinction means that non-GamStop casinos do not enforce GamStop restrictions, allowing players who have registered for self-exclusion in the UK to continue gambling on these platforms. For some, this offers a chance to enjoy casino games without interruptions, but it also comes with important considerations around player safety and responsibility.
